
算四章数控偏程常用指令 一、选择题 1、I50标准规定增量尺寸方式的指令为(B). A)G90 B)G91 C)G92 D)G93 2、沿刀具前进方向观察,刀具偏在工件轮养的左边是B指令,刀具偏在工件轮廓的右边是 (C)指令, A)G40 B)G41 C)G42 3、刀具长度正补信是(A)指令,负补偿是(B》指令,取消补偿是(C)指令。 A)G43 B)G44 C)G49 4、在徒削工件时,若铁刀的羹转方向与工件的进给方向相反称为(B)。 》顺铣助逆铣C横峡D)纵铣 5、圆红插补指令G03XYR中,X、Y后的值表示复的(B). 》起点坐标值B)锋点坐标植C)圆心坐标相对于起点的值 6、G00指令与下列的(C》指令不是同一组的. A0G01B助G02,C03C)G0M 7、下列G指令中(C)是丰模态指令。 A0G00周G01C)G04 8、Gl7、G18、G19指令可用来选择(C)的平面. 》曲线插补册直线插补C)刀具半径补整 9、用于指令动作方式的准备功能的指令代码是(B), A》F代码B卧G代码 C0T代码 10、辅助功能中表示无条件程序暂停的粉令是(A)。 A》00B助01C)02)30 11、执行下列程序后。累计智停进给时间是(A): N1G91C00X120.0Y800 2G43Z-32.001 3G01Z-21.0F120 N GO1 P1000 N5G00Z21.0
第四章 数控编程常用指令 一、 选择题 1、ISO 标准规定增量尺寸方式的指令为( B )。 A) G90 B) G91 C) G92 D)G93 2、沿刀具前进方向观察,刀具偏在工件轮廓的左边是 B 指令,刀具偏在工件轮廓的右边是 ( C ) 指令。 A) G40 B) G41 C) G42 3、刀具长度正补偿是( A ) 指令,负补偿是( B ) 指令,取消补偿是( C ) 指令。 A) G43 B) G44 C) G49 4、在铣削工件时,若铣刀的旋转方向与工件的进给方向相反称为( B )。 A) 顺铣 B) 逆铣 C) 横铣 D) 纵铣 5、圆弧插补指令 G03 X Y R 中,X、Y 后的值表示圆弧的( B )。 A) 起点坐标值 B)终点坐标值 C)圆心坐标相对于起点的值 6、G00 指令与下列的( C ) 指令不是同一组的。 A) G01 B) G02,G03 C) G04 7、下列 G 指令中( C ) 是非模态指令。 A) G00 B) G01 C) G04 8、G17、G18、G19 指令可用来选择( C ) 的平面。 A) 曲线插补 B) 直线插补 C)刀具半径补偿 9、 用于指令动作方式的准备功能的指令代码是 ( B )。 A)F 代码 B)G 代码 C)T 代码 10、 辅助功能中表示无条件程序暂停的指令是 ( A )。 A) M00 B) M01 C) M02 D) M30 11 、执行下列程序后,累计暂停进给时间是 ( A )。 N1 G91 G00 X120.0 Y80.0 N2 G43 Z-32.0 H01 N3 G01 Z-21.0 F120 N4 G04 P1000 N5 G00 Z21.0

6X30.0Y-50.0 N7G01Z-41.0F120 8G042.0 9G49G00255.0 N10M02 A》3秒 剧2秒 C01002秒 D)1.002秒 12、G00的指令移动速度值是(A). A)机床参数指定 卧数控程序指定 C)操作面板指定 13、圆弧超补段程序中,若采用圆竿径R编程时,从起始点到铁点存在两条圆弧线段,当 (D)时,用一R表示圆弧率径。 》图弧小于或等于180°)国领大于域等于180°日圈儿小于180°D)圆大于 180 14、以下提法中(C)是错误的. A》92是慎态提令 卧C043.0表示暂停3sC)G33ZF中的F表示进给量 )G41是刀具左补能 15、程序终了到,以何种指令表示(C)。 A》00B盼01 C)o 9 D)M03 16、程序无误,但在执行时,所有的X移动方向对程序原点面言皆相反,下列何种原因最有 可能(B)。 A》发生警报 )X轴设定货料被修改过 C)未回白机械原点 D)深度补 正符号相反。 17、Q铣床如工程序中呼叫子程序的折令是(C)。 A0G98B)G99C098D)99 18、刀具长度补偿值的地址用(B》, A)D B)H C)R D)J 19、G92的作用是(B)。 》设定刀具的长度补偿值卧设定工件坐标系)设定机床坐标系D)增量坐 标编醒 20.数控车床在(B)指令下工作时,进给修调无效, A》G03B盼G32C)086D0G81
N6 X30.0 Y-50.0 N7 G01 Z-41.0 F120 N8 G04 X2.0 N9 G49 G00 Z55.0 N10 M02 A) 3 秒 B) 2 秒 C)1002 秒 D) 1.002 秒 12、G00 的指令移动速度值是( A )。 A) 机床参数指定 B)数控程序指定 C)操作面板指定 13、圆弧插补段程序中,若采用圆弧半径R编程时,从起始点到终点存在两条圆弧线段,当 ( D ) 时,用-R表示圆弧半径。 A) 圆弧小于或等于 180° B) 圆弧大于或等于 180° C) 圆弧小于 180° D) 圆弧大于 180° 14、以下提法中( C ) 是错误的。 A) G92 是模态提令 B) G04 X3.0 表示暂停 3s C) G33 Z F 中的 F 表示进给量 D) G41 是刀具左补偿 15、程序终了时,以何种指令表示 ( C )。 A) M00 B) M01 C)M02 D) M03 16、程序无误,但在执行时,所有的X移动方向对程序原点而言皆相反,下列何种原因最有 可能 ( B )。 A) 发生警报 B) X轴设定资料被修改过 C) 未回归机械原点 D) 深度补 正符号相反。 17、CNC 铣床加工程序中呼叫子程序的指令是( C )。 A) G98 B) G99 C) M98 D) M99 18、 刀具长度补偿值的地址用( B )。 A) D B) H C) R D) J 19、 G92 的作用是( B )。 A) 设定刀具的长度补偿值 B) 设定工件坐标系 C) 设定机床坐标系 D) 增量坐 标编程 20、数控车床在( B ) 指令下工作时,进给修调无效。 A) G03 B) G32 C) G96 D) G81

21、用棒料毛还,加工余量较大且不均匀的盘类零作,应选用的复合循环指令是(B), A0G71 B間G72C0G73 D)G76 二、填空题 1、国际上通用的数挖代码是(EIA代码)和(1S0代码》, 2、刀具位置补德包括(长度补偿》和(半径补偿) 3、使用返日参考点指令28时,应〔取酒刀具补:功能》,否则机床无法返回参考点 4、在指定四定循环之前,必须用辅助功能(03)使主轴《旋转) 5、建立或取消刀具华径补偿的偏置是在(G01、G00霸令)的执行过程中完成的 6,在返回动作中,用G98指定刀具返日(初始平面)用的指定刀具返回(R点平面)· 7、车床数控系统中,进行恒线速度控制的指令是(G96) 8、子程序结束并返目主程序的指令是(的) 9、直轻编程指令是(G36) 10、进给量的单位有m/r和n/im其指令分别为(G95)和(G94) 11. 在数控铣床上加工整圆时,为避免工件表而产生刀痕,刀具从起始点沿圆风表而的 (切线方向)进入,进行周儿锐削加工整圆加工完毕退刀时,顺着周氧表面的(切线方 向)退出。 三、判断题 1.顺时针图弧插补G02)和逆时计圆弧插补G3)的判别方向是:沿着不在圆平面内的坐 标轴正方向向负方向看去,顺时针方向为G02,逆时针方向为G03。(√) 2、程序段的顺序号,根据数控系统的不同,在某感系统中可以省略的。(,) 3、G代码可以分为模态G代码和非模态G代码。(√》 《、数控机床编程有绝对值和增量值编程,使用时不能将它们成在同一程序段中。(×) 5、G00、G01指令都能使机床坐标轴准确到位,因此它们都是插补指令。(×) 6、圆1插补用半径编程时,当圆烈所对应的圆心角大干1800时半径取货值.(√) 7、不同的数控机床可能选用不同的数控系统,但数控加工程序指令都是相同的。(×) 8、数挖车床的刀具功能学T既指定了刀具数,又指定了刀具号,(×》 11、螺纹指◆G32x41,0-43.0F1,5是以每分钟1,5m的速度加工螺纹。(×) 9、在数控加工中,如果圆弧指令后的半径遗漏,则圆弧指令作直线指令执行。(×》 10、车床的进给方式分每分钟进给和每转进给两种,一般可用G94和G95区分。(、) 11、刀具补偿功能包括刀补的建立,刀补的执行和刀补的取消三个阶段。(√)
21、用棒料毛坯,加工余量较大且不均匀的盘类零件,应选用的复合循环指令是( B )。 A) G71 B) G72 C) G73 D) G76 二、填空题 1、国际上通用的数控代码是 ( EIA 代码 )和 ( ISO 代码 ) 。 2、刀具位置补偿包括 ( 长度补偿 ) 和 ( 半径补偿 ) 3、使用返回参考点指令 G28 时,应 ( 取消刀具补偿功能 ) ,否则机床无法返回参考点 4、在指定固定循环之前,必须用辅助功能 ( M03 ) 使主轴 ( 旋转 ) 5、建立或取消刀具半径补偿的偏置是在 ( G01、G00 指令) 的执行过程中完成的 6、在返回动作中,用 G98 指定刀具返回 ( 初始平面 ) 用 G99 指定刀具返回 ( R 点平面 ) 。 7、车床数控系统中,进行恒线速度控制的指令是 ( G96 ) 8、子程序结束并返回主程序的指令是 ( M99 ) 9、直径编程指令是 ( G36 ) 10、 进给量的单位有 mm/r 和 mm/min 其指令分别为 ( G95 ) 和 ( G94 ) 11、 在数控铣床上加工整圆时,为避免工件表面产生刀痕,刀具从起始点沿圆弧表面的 ( 切线方向 )进入,进行圆弧铣削加工整圆加工完毕退刀时,顺着圆弧表面的( 切线方 向 )退出。 三、 判断题 1、顺时针圆弧插补(G02)和逆时针圆弧插补(G03)的判别方向是:沿着不在圆弧平面内的坐 标轴正方向向负方向看去,顺时针方向为 G02,逆时针方向为 G03。 ( √ ) 2、程序段的顺序号,根据数控系统的不同,在某些系统中可以省略的。 ( √ ) 3、G 代码可以分为模态 G 代码和非模态 G 代码。 ( √ ) 4、数控机床编程有绝对值和增量值编程,使用时不能将它们放在同一程序段中。 ( × ) 5、G00、G01 指令都能使机床坐标轴准确到位,因此它们都是插补指令。 ( × ) 6、圆弧插补用半径编程时,当圆弧所对应的圆心角大于 180o 时半径取负值。 ( √ ) 7、不同的数控机床可能选用不同的数控系统,但数控加工程序指令都是相同的。 ( × ) 8、数控车床的刀具功能字 T 既指定了刀具数,又指定了刀具号。 ( × ) 11、螺纹指令 G32 X41.0 W-43.0 F1.5 是以每分钟 1.5mm 的速度加工螺纹。 ( × ) 9、在数控加工中,如果圆弧指令后的半径遗漏,则圆弧指令作直线指令执行。 ( × ) 10、车床的进给方式分每分钟进给和每转进给两种,一般可用 G94 和 G95 区分。 ( √ ) 11、刀具补偿功能包括刀补的建立、刀补的执行和刀补的取消三个阶段。 ( √ )

12、数控机床以G代码作为数控语言。(×) 13、G40是数控编程中的刀具左补德指令。(×) 14、移动指令和平面选择指令无关。(×) 15、G92指令一校放在程序第一段,该指令不引起机味动作。(√) 16、G04X3.0表示智停3s。(×》 17、指令2为程序结束,同时使程序还原(像est)。(√) 18、制作C程序时,90与G91不宜在同一单节内。(√) 19、000和G01的运行轨迹一样,只是速度不一样(×) 20、在镜像功能有效后,刀具在任何位置都可以实现镜像指令(×) 四、简答题 1、690200Y15.0与G的1X200Y15,0有什么区别? 答:G30表示绝对尺寸编程,X200、Y15.0表示的参考点坐标值是绝对坐标值。G91表示 增量尺寸编程。X20.0、Y15.0表示的参考点坐标值是相对简一参考点的坐标值。 2、简运0与G01程序授的主要区别? 答:G00带令要求刀具以点位控制方式从刀具所在位置用最快的速度移动到指定位置,快 速点定位移动速度不能用程序指令设定,C01是以直线插补运算联动方式由某坐标点移动到 另一坐标点,移动速度由进给功能指令下投定,机床执行1指令时,程序段中必须含有下 指令。 3、刀具运回参考点的指令有儿个?各在什么情况上使用? 答,刀具返日参考点的指令有两个,G28指令可以使刀具从任何位置以快速定位方式经中 间点返同参考点,常用于刀具自动换刀的程序段,G2图折令使刀具从参考点经由一个中间点 而定位于定位终点。它通常紧跟在28指令之后,用G29指令使所有的被指◆的轴以快速进 给经由以前G28指令定义的中同点,然后到达指定点。 4、读程序绘出零件轮廓。 1000 G92X0Y0Z50 G90G00X-100Y-10003s500 Z507 G01Z-12F200 G42X-85Y-80D0LF120
12、数控机床以 G 代码作为数控语言。( × ) 13、G40 是数控编程中的刀具左补偿指令。( × ) 14、移动指令和平面选择指令无关。( × ) 15、G92 指令一般放在程序第一段,该指令不引起机床动作。( √ ) 16、G04 X3.0 表示暂停 3ms。( × ) 17、指令 M02 为程序结束,同时使程序还原(Reset)。( √ ) 18、制作 NC 程序时,G90 与 G91 不宜在同一单节内。( √ ) 19、G00 和 G01 的运行轨迹一样,只是速度不一样(× ) 20、在镜像功能有效后,刀具在任何位置都可以实现镜像指令( × ) 四、简答题 1、G90 X20.0 Y15.0 与 G91 X20.0 Y15.0 有什么区别? 答: G90 表示绝对尺寸编程,X20.0、Y15.0 表示的参考点坐标值是绝对坐标值。G91 表示 增量尺寸编程,X20.0、Y15.0 表示的参考点坐标值是相对前一参考点的坐标值。 2、简述 G00 与 G01 程序段的主要区别? 答: G00 指令要求刀具以点位控制方式从刀具所在位置用最快的速度移动到指定位置,快 速点定位移动速度不能用程序指令设定。G01 是以直线插补运算联动方式由某坐标点移动到 另一坐标点,移动速度由进给功能指令 F 设定,机床执行 G01 指令时,程序段中必须含有 F 指令。 3、刀具返回参考点的指令有几个?各在什么情况上使用? 答:刀具返回参考点的指令有两个。 G28 指令可以使刀具从任何位置以快速定位方式经中 间点返回参考点,常用于刀具自动换刀的程序段。G29 指令使刀具从参考点经由一个中间点 而定位于定位终点。它通常紧跟在 G28 指令之后。用 G29 指令使所有的被指令的轴以快速进 给经由以前 G28 指令定义的中间点,然后到达指定点。 4、读程序绘出零件轮廓。 %1000 G92 X0 Y0 Z50 G90 G00 X-100 Y-100 M03 S500 Z5 M07 G01 Z-12 F200 G42 X-85 Y-80 D01 F120

0 G02X40G913050 G01X40Y90 G9003X40Y50R-30 G01X0Y80 G03X-80Y0-80 G01Y-90 G40G00X-100Y-100 Z5003 XO YO M05 M30
X0 G02 X40 G91 Y30 R50 G01 X40 Y90 G90 G03 X40 Y50 R-30 G01 X0 Y80 G03 X-80 Y0 J-80 G01 Y-90 G40 G00 X-100 Y-100 Z50 M09 X0 Y0 M05 M30